Platelets, or thrombocytes, are small blood cell fragments that assist in blood clotting and help stop bleeding. Clinicians can identify a high platelet count through routine blood tests. A high platelet count can indicate an underlying condition.

WebFeb 25, 2024 · In adults, this may be triggered by infection with HIV, hepatitis or H. pylori — the type of bacteria that causes stomach ulcers. In most children with ITP, the disorder follows a viral illness, such as the mumps or the flu. Risk factors ITP is more common among young women.
